Defence Ministry starts inquiry into chopper crash

Herald Reporter

AN inquiry into the cause of the crash of an Air Force of Zimbabwe helicopter in Masvingo on Sunday has opened, the Ministry of Defence said in a statement.

The ministry said the accident occurred at Masvingo Aerodrome on September 15.

“The helicopter had two pilots and four passengers on board when it developed a problem during the transition phase of take-off,” reads the statement.

“Fortunately, there were no fatalities from the crew, passengers, and personnel on the ground.

“An inquiry into the cause of the accident by the Ministry of Defence in conjunction with the Civil Aviation Authority of Zimbabwe is underway.”
